(Albany, NY)- Senator John J. Bonacic (R/C/I-Mt. Hope) attended and delivered remarks today, at the annual Emergency Medical Services Memorial Dedication Ceremony in Albany. Bonacic was joined by members of the legislature, honored guests, and EMS professionals from around the state to pay respect to the men and women who keep us safe in our communities. This year, the names of Thomas V. Giammarino, William C. Olsen, Douglas Mulholland, Luis de Pena, Jr. of FDNY EMS, and Barry Miller of the Bergen Fire Department, and Ralph E. Oswald of the Hampton Bays Volunteer Ambulance, were added to the memorial wall.
